Ordinals
beta
Address 115W95zSgc4EphhJZwtcX7WJVRbJM5BwVv
sat balance
30000
outputs
cd5dead94124e2c79a8690c111e4e0632551913285426a59ba2a8c62f302de51:2
e96b34cd0e1ae3d5409d3fffc1cd3ad6e9db5041c9f98c0957c0320ae6c1df69:6
391450b6f8b5e883f6afe5bfdac279ceff2ed61baffd074b97b26d4284b3e280:4